Habitat:
Growing along the road in a sheltered pocket surrounded by Typha latifolia. Assoc.: Glyceria spp., incl. G. striata, Poa palustris, Sagittaria latifolia, Sparganium eurycarpum, and Asclepias incarnata. Clone spreading rapidly by densely shooted rhizomes. Tips of some rhizomes contained bulblets or shoots that might easily become detached. Some pls were attached to loose organic substrate on patch edges, but most pls of interior were floating in a mat.
